Miramar Beach Resort

4200 Gulf Blvd
St. Pete Beach, Florida
See map below for directions from Miramar Beach Resort to Saint Pete Beach Access (0.3 miles)

Check room rates and availability

Book a room at
MIRAMAR BEACH RESORT